Overview
\"King Richard III depicts the rise, reign and fall of the ruthless Duke of Gloucester. Shakespeare presents a masterful study in the language of deception and manipulation in the character of Richard wo lies, persuades, and kills on his path to the throne. This study guide provides insight into the rhetoric of key speeches and pays specific attention to the changing perceptions of King Richard III in history and art. The final section focuses on giving students the necessary tools and skills needed for writing effective and comprehensive essays\"--Provided by publisher.
